Aufreinigung
This antibody is purified through a protein A column, followed by peptide affinity purification.
Immunogen
This DANRE hoxc11a antibody is generated from rabbits immunized with a KLH conjugated synthetic peptide between 1-30 amino acids from the N-terminal region of DANRE hoxc11a.
Purified polyclonal antibody supplied in PBS with 0.09 % (W/V) sodium azide.

Hintergrund
Sequence-specific transcription factor which is part of a developmental regulatory system that provides cells with specific positional identities on the anterior-posterior axis (By similarity).
